Poly lifting involves the use of polyurethane foam to lift and level various structures, often used in residential and small commercial projects near Primm Springs, TN. This method provides a non-invasive option for addressing uneven slabs, walkways, and other concrete surfaces.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for poly lifting services.
- Materials primarily consist of specialized polyurethane foam designed for structural lifting and stabilization.
- The scope generally includes lifting specific concrete slabs or sections, with sizes varying based on project needs.
- Labor complexity is moderate, often requiring precise application and monitoring to achieve desired results.
- Permitting requirements depend on local regulations and the extent of work performed; some projects may need permits.
- Additional options can include surface repair, crack sealing, or reinforcement to ensure long-term stability.
